If [tex]y = -4[/tex] when [tex]x = 10[/tex], determine [tex]y[/tex] when [tex]x = 5[/tex].

There's no way to answer that with the information given.
' Y ' might be -0.4x . Then, when ' x ' is 5, ' y ' is -2 .
OR, ' y ' could be x-14. Then, when ' x ' is 5, ' y ' is -9 .
There's just not enough given information to know.
